First Stream: Essy Explores Confidence, Inner-Strength, Sexuality, and Self-Discovery on New EP “Cry For Me”

Singer/songwriter Essy has been gearing up for the release of her sophomore EP Cry For Me for what feels like forever. Beaming with excitement to share her latest project with the world, the Nashville-based EDM prodigy gives Celeb Secrets readers a first listen at Cry For Me, along with an inside look at the lead single’s music video hours before its big debut.

Paying homage to her EDM background with four-on-the-floor drum arrangements and side-chained synth grooves, Essy’s new set of songs are offset by clean, simplistic vocals that pack hard-hitting lyrics to make you cry and slick synthpop beats to make you dance while you’re doing it.

“I really wanted listeners to have their own emotional experience when listening to the EP,” she tells Celeb Secrets. “The track begins with this effervescent, lifting synth intro and then carries into this angry, energetic heater on ‘Break A Heart,’ and then swells back down for an intimate serenade on ‘Missing Me Missing You.’ It’s both high and low, aggressive then tame. I hope listeners feel this push and pull within them as they listen so that they, too, explore new emotional depths.”

Describing the extended play as “fierce, liberating, and intimate,” Essy tells Celeb Secrets that Cry For Me is “the most empowering project” that she’s been apart of.

“It’s about rebirth… learning to start over again, re-finding trust in yourself, making peace with your deepest fears, and embracing the pain of the past,” she explains. “It’s my personal journey wrapped into a sonic emotional saga. I feel deeply connected to each track and very much and remember what I experienced when writing each song. I’m grateful for this album because it also challenged me to express emotion beyond lyric writing. I really got to dive into production and find new ways to connect to my music.”

The project’s lead single was written about her experience with pride, facing her own and seeing it in other people. “When I was writing the song, I felt like I was staring at the face of ‘pride’ itself and trying to kick down its walls to get some sort of emotional connection out of it,” she says, “I want people to crave that energy when they hear the track.”

Born into the fire, Essy (born Rachel Braig) cut her teeth in both the Berklee College of Music and New York University Steinhardt School’s early songwriting programs, learning from and writing alongside industry veterans Barry Eastmond (Aretha Franklin, Whitney Houston) and Maia Sharpe (Carole KingThe Dixie Chicks), as well as pop songwriter Michael Pollack (LauvCeline Dion).

After a piano ballad she composed out of her college dormitory caught the attention of Atlantic Records electronic duo Ship Wrek, Essy’s first cut with NCS Records Star Party soon followed, and an early graduation prompted a move to Nashville to begin songwriting and producing full-time alongside some of pop’s most promising penners, including Johnluke Lewis (LANY), Jintae Ko (OneRepublic), Paris Carney (Adam Lambert), Mike Pappas (Meghan Trainor), and Hunter Hayes.

Growing interest in Essy’s tracks and vocal collaborations encouraged her to jumpstart her own musical project, and in 2019, she began releasing her solo material, racking up over 4 million streams and 75k monthly listeners on Spotify alone. Her latest project Cry For Me details the end of a relationship and highlighting themes of confidence, inner-strength, sexuality, and self-discovery and sets the budding musician into stardom with its down-to-earth, moody feel.
